Understanding Pillager Spawn Mechanics

Pillagers, unlike many other mobs, don't spawn randomly. Their appearance is governed by specific game mechanics, primarily tied to patrols and outposts.

Patrols: The Wandering Threat

Patrols are groups of pillagers that naturally spawn in certain biomes. These groups are relatively small and usually wander around aimlessly. While less of a threat than a full-blown raid, they still pose a danger, especially if you're unprepared. Their spawning depends on the light level; they only spawn in areas with a light level of 7 or less.

Outposts: The Epicenter of Pillager Activity

Pillager outposts are structures that generate in various biomes, acting as a central spawning point for pillagers. These outposts usually contain several pillagers, and their presence significantly increases the chance of raids occurring nearby. The presence of an outpost near your base is the primary reason for frequent pillager encounters.

Strategies to Stop Pillager Spawning

Several effective methods exist to minimize or completely eliminate pillager spawning around your base.

1. Distance is Your Friend

The simplest method is to build far away from any pillager outposts. Pillagers, like many other hostile mobs, have a limited spawning range. The further your base is from an outpost, the less likely you are to encounter them.

2. Lighting Up the Night

Proper lighting is crucial. Remember, pillagers require a low light level to spawn. Thoroughly illuminating the area around your base—including caves and structures nearby— significantly reduces their chances of spawning. Use torches, lanterns, or other light sources to achieve a light level of 8 or higher.

3. Destroy the Outpost (The Ultimate Solution)

The most effective, albeit potentially dangerous, solution is to eliminate the pillager outpost completely. Destroying the outpost removes the primary spawning point for pillagers in the area, drastically reducing their presence. Be prepared for a fight, as the outpost will typically contain several pillagers, and the battle may attract additional patrols.

4. Modify Biomes (Advanced Techniques)

For players with experience in world manipulation using commands or mods, altering the biome around your base can prevent pillager spawns. Certain biomes have a lower likelihood of pillager patrols. This method requires advanced knowledge of Minecraft mechanics and should only be attempted by experienced players.
